The TFM-147-32-L-D-A-P-TR is a SAMTEC Tiger Eye high-reliability dual-row right-angle terminal strip with 0.050-inch (1.27 mm) pitch and 94 total pins. It enables lateral board-to-board connections in high-density electronics assemblies. Available in tape-and-reel format with worldwide shipping.

What are the key features of TFM-147-32-L-D-A-P-TR?
- 94-pin dual-row configuration at 0.050 inch (1.27 mm) pitch enabling extremely high signal density in a right-angle SMT connector
- Right-angle (L) termination style supporting lateral board exit to minimize stack height in multi-PCB chassis assemblies
- Tiger Eye contact system proven for high-reliability operation across vibration, shock, and thermal cycling from -55°C to +125°C
- Tape-and-reel (TR) packaging ensuring automated pick-and-place compatibility for streamlined SMT production
What is TFM-147-32-L-D-A-P-TR used for?
The TFM-147-32-L-D-A-P-TR serves high-density signal interconnect needs in defense electronics, industrial computing, and telecommunications equipment requiring 94 pins through a single right-angle SMT connector at 0.050 inch pitch. Its compact dual-row footprint is ideal for FPGA mezzanine cards, high-speed backplanes, and multi-channel signal processing boards where both pin density and lateral connector access are critical design requirements. The right-angle orientation enables front-panel access to the 94-pin interface without disturbing surrounding board components.

How does the TFM-147-32-L-D-A-P-TR achieve 94 pins while maintaining a compact PCB footprint?
The TFM-147-32-L-D-A-P-TR achieves 94 total pins by using a dual-row arrangement at a fine 0.050 inch (1.27 mm) pitch, which is half the spacing of standard 2.54 mm pitch connectors. This configuration fits 47 contacts per row within a connector body spanning approximately 60 mm in length, delivering 94 signals in roughly the same board length as a 30-pin connector at standard 2.54 mm pitch.
What temperature range does the TFM-147-32-L-D-A-P-TR support, and is it suitable for harsh environments?
The TFM-147-32-L-D-A-P-TR's Tiger Eye contact system is rated for operation across a temperature range of -55°C to +125°C, covering both extreme cold environments such as outdoor industrial installations and elevated temperature environments such as engine control modules and avionics bays. This wide thermal range, combined with vibration and shock resistance, qualifies the connector for harsh aerospace and defense applications where standard commercial connectors would fail.

How does tape-and-reel packaging of the TFM-147-32-L-D-A-P-TR benefit high-volume manufacturing?
The tape-and-reel (TR) packaging of the TFM-147-32-L-D-A-P-TR enables automated SMT pick-and-place machines to feed, orient, and place the 94-pin connector without manual intervention, reducing placement cycle time to under 2 seconds per component and achieving consistent positioning accuracy within 0.1 mm. This is essential for high-volume production runs of hundreds or thousands of PCBs, where manual connector placement would introduce variability and increase assembly cost per unit.
